Address

1DgQgeESQh9jBwR2gw7bVJQG7cbXVmLSoB
Confirmed tx count
49
Confirmed received
29 outputs (1.42454396 BTC)
Confirmed spent
29 outputs (1.42454396 BTC)
Confirmed unspent
No outputs

25 of 49 Transactions